XCV300E-6FG456C BGA-256 逻辑门:深入解析

XCV300E-6FG456C BGA-256 是赛灵思(Xilinx)公司生产的 Virtex-E 系列 FPGA,属于低成本、低功耗、高性能的器件,广泛应用于数字信号处理、图像处理、通信、工业控制等领域。本文将从多个方面对该逻辑门进行详细分析,旨在提供全面的了解。

一、 概述

XCV300E-6FG456C BGA-256 是一款基于 Virtex-E 架构的 FPGA,拥有 300,000 个可配置逻辑门,以及 6 个 18x18 乘法器。其封装形式为 BGA-256,拥有 256 个引脚,提供丰富的 I/O 端口,可以满足各种应用需求。

二、 主要特点

* 高逻辑门密度: 该器件拥有 300,000 个可配置逻辑门,能够实现复杂的数字电路设计。

* 高速性能: Virtex-E 架构提供了高速的内部连接和数据传输能力,支持高达 200MHz 的工作频率。

* 低功耗: 该器件采用低功耗设计,能够有效降低功耗,延长电池寿命,适用于移动设备和便携式电子设备。

* 灵活的 I/O 端口: BGA-256 封装形式提供丰富的 I/O 端口,可以满足不同应用的接口需求。

* 丰富的片上资源: 除了逻辑门之外,该器件还拥有 6 个 18x18 乘法器、片上存储器、PLL 和其他辅助电路,满足不同应用需求。

三、 架构分析

XCV300E-6FG456C BGA-256 采用 Virtex-E 架构,主要包含以下几个关键部分:

* 可配置逻辑块 (CLB): CLB 是 FPGA 的核心,包含查找表 (LUT)、触发器和连接矩阵。LUT 用于实现逻辑函数,触发器用于存储数据,连接矩阵用于连接 CLB 内部和外部的信号。

* 乘法器: 该器件拥有 6 个 18x18 乘法器,能够进行快速高效的乘法运算。

* 输入/输出块 (IOB): IOB 提供了与外部设备连接的接口,支持各种电压等级和信号类型。

* 块 RAM: 片上存储器用于存储数据和代码,可以有效提高运行速度。

* PLL: 片上锁相环用于产生不同频率的时钟信号,满足不同应用需求。

* 内部连接网络: 内部连接网络用于连接 CLB、乘法器、IOB 和其他片上资源,保证数据传输的效率。

四、 应用场景

XCV300E-6FG456C BGA-256 由于其高性能、低功耗和灵活的 I/O 端口,在以下领域有着广泛的应用:

* 数字信号处理: 该器件可以实现各种数字信号处理算法,例如音频处理、图像处理、视频编码等。

* 通信系统: 该器件可以用于设计通信协议和高速数据传输模块,例如无线通信、网络设备等。

* 工业控制: 该器件可以用于工业自动化控制系统,例如电机控制、传感器采集等。

* 测试与测量: 该器件可以用于设计测试仪器和测量设备,例如信号发生器、频谱分析仪等。

* 教育与研究: 该器件可以用于教学和科研,帮助学生和研究人员学习和探索数字电路设计。

五、 开发与设计

Xilinx 提供了丰富的开发工具和软件资源,帮助用户进行 XCV300E-6FG456C BGA-256 的开发和设计:

* Vivado Design Suite: Vivado Design Suite 是赛灵思最新一代的开发工具,支持 XCV300E-6FG456C BGA-256 的逻辑设计、仿真、综合、布局布线和下载等功能。

* Xilinx ISE: Xilinx ISE 是早期的开发工具,也支持 XCV300E-6FG456C BGA-256 的开发。

* HDL 语言: 可以使用 Verilog 或 VHDL 等硬件描述语言编写设计代码。

* IP 核: Xilinx 提供了丰富的 IP 核,可以用于实现各种功能模块,简化设计过程。

六、 优势与不足

优势:

* 高性能:高工作频率,可以实现高速数字电路设计。

* 低功耗:低功耗设计,适用于移动设备和便携式电子设备。

* 灵活的 I/O 端口:BGA-256 封装形式提供了丰富的 I/O 端口。

* 丰富的片上资源:包含 CLB、乘法器、片上存储器、PLL 等,满足多种应用需求。

不足:

* 逻辑门密度较低:与更高端的 FPGA 相比,逻辑门密度较低。

* 价格相对较高:与一些低端 FPGA 相比,价格相对较高。

七、 结论

XCV300E-6FG456C BGA-256 是一款性能出色、功能丰富的 FPGA,适用于各种数字电路设计,尤其是需要高速性能和低功耗的应用。该器件拥有丰富的片上资源和灵活的 I/O 端口,可以满足不同应用的需求。凭借其优秀的性能和良好的开发工具支持,XCV300E-6FG456C BGA-256 在数字信号处理、通信、工业控制等领域具有广泛的应用前景。

八、 参考资料

* [赛灵思官网](/)

* [Xilinx Virtex-E 系列 FPGA 产品手册]()

* [Vivado Design Suite 用户指南]()

* [Xilinx ISE 用户指南]()

九、 关键词

XCV300E-6FG456C、FPGA、Virtex-E、逻辑门、数字信号处理、通信、工业控制、开发工具、Vivado Design Suite、Xilinx ISE、HDL语言、IP 核、优势、不足。

希望以上内容能够帮助您全面了解 XCV300E-6FG456C BGA-256 逻辑门,并对您在相关领域的研究和开发工作有所帮助。